Using Google Analytics with AIR Applications?

I was really excited when I first heard about gaforflash, becuase I thought I’d be able to track events within my AIR applications.  Sadly, this is not the case…yet (the team has AIR integration on the roadmap).  The obvious question, then, is are there any solutions out there for using Google Analytics with AIR applications?
